Neighborhood Overview

Midlakes High School is situated in Clifton Springs, a village in Ontario County, New York. The school is easily accessible via State Route 488, a key local artery connecting to larger highways. For those arriving from further afield, the Greater Rochester International Airport (ROC) is the primary gateway, typically a 45- to 60-minute drive depending on traffic. Major routes like I-90 and NY-332 are within reasonable proximity, facilitating travel to and from the school grounds. Parking is available on-site, with specific lots designated for athletic events and school functions. During peak event times, local road traffic can increase, making early arrival advisable. Rideshare services are available but may have longer wait times compared to larger metropolitan areas.

Where to Stay

Hotel accommodations tend to be clustered in the nearby city of Canandaigua, about a 15-minute drive east, or in Geneva, approximately 20 minutes further. While Clifton Springs itself is a smaller village with limited hotel options directly adjacent to the school, these nearby communities offer a range of choices from budget-friendly motels to more established hotel chains. Many families and teams opt for accommodations in Canandaigua due to its proximity and the wider selection of dining and shopping amenities. Booking in advance is highly recommended, especially during peak sports seasons or when the school hosts major tournaments, as availability can become limited quickly. Local Tips

Weekend tournaments often draw large crowds, meaning parking lots fill up quickly: early arrival is key.

Local restaurants: , especially in Canandaigua, can get very busy on Friday and Saturday evenings, consider reservations.

While Clifton Springs is small, residents are generally friendly and helpful: don't hesitate to ask for local advice.

Seasonal note: The Midlakes High School area experiences distinct seasons. Spring and fall offer pleasant temperatures ideal for outdoor events, though can sometimes bring unpredictable weather or late snow in early spring and fall. Summer brings warmer, humid conditions, making water activities and shaded areas popular. Winter is cold and can involve snow, potentially impacting travel and requiring warm clothing for any outdoor activities. Event schedules are generally robust during spring, summer, and fall.
